120L anti-static trash cans are primarily used in static-sensitive areas.

These cans are designed for specific environments sensitive to static electricity, such as cleanrooms in electronics factories, laboratories, and precision instrument workshops. They are used to safely collect, process, and hold waste that generates static electricity (such as electronic component packaging and waste test paper), preventing static buildup from causing sparks or damaging sensitive electronic components, thus ensuring a safe production environment and product quality.

Protecting electronic products: Preventing permanent damage to microcircuits caused by electrostatic discharge (ESD) during the production and repair of electronic equipment.

Cleanroom environments: Meeting the environmental control requirements of cleanrooms and reducing static electricity-induced dust adsorption.

Safe production: Preventing accidents caused by static sparks in flammable and explosive areas (such as paint booths).

Categorized storage: Typically black in design to distinguish it from ordinary trash cans, it is used for disposing of dry waste that does not contain liquid (such as packaging bags and waste paper).

Why 120L?

The 120L capacity is large, suitable for industrial production lines or large workstations that require handling large amounts of waste, facilitating centralized management and reducing the frequency of emptying. Features: Antistatic Material: Injection molded from antistatic plastic, with stable conductivity, non-surface coating, and high durability.

Safe and Reliable: Safely conducts static charge to the ground, preventing instantaneous release and providing safety assurance.

In short, it is a professional industrial antistatic product, an indispensable safety and environmental protection facility for industries such as electronics, semiconductors, and pharmaceuticals.
